Output 650581b301023fd78ce404a6f711ac9fcffd41b55b764a431cdf66b24c9211f8:8

value
1885513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c1c83c544b169de9ebc1ad9210feebe51889eb OP_EQUAL
address
38xjSvHpi7Dws7EWBVAwGZyfU38zp2p4WU
transaction
650581b301023fd78ce404a6f711ac9fcffd41b55b764a431cdf66b24c9211f8
spent
true